#1
Which suffix means 'condition of'?
ia
ExplanationSuffix 'ia' signifies the condition of.
#2
The suffix '-ectomy' refers to:
removal or excision
ExplanationThe suffix '-ectomy' indicates the removal or excision of a part.
#3
Which suffix denotes 'abnormal condition or disease'?
opathy
ExplanationSuffix 'opathy' indicates abnormal condition or disease.
#4
The suffix '-centesis' in medical terminology refers to what procedure?
surgical puncture to remove fluid
ExplanationThe procedure indicated by the suffix '-centesis' is surgical puncture to remove fluid.
#5
Which suffix means 'surgical fixation or fusion'?
desis
ExplanationSuffix 'desis' means surgical fixation or fusion.
#6
The suffix '-genic' in medical terminology denotes:
origin
ExplanationThe suffix '-genic' denotes origin.
#7
What does the suffix '-algia' denote?
pain
ExplanationThe suffix '-algia' denotes pain.
#8
The suffix '-pathy' in medical terminology refers to:
disease
ExplanationThe suffix '-pathy' refers to disease.
#9
What does the suffix '-rrhaphy' signify?
surgical repair
ExplanationThe suffix '-rrhaphy' signifies surgical repair.
#10
The suffix '-ostomy' in medical terminology indicates:
surgical creation of an opening
ExplanationThe suffix '-ostomy' indicates the surgical creation of an opening.
#11
What does the suffix '-penia' signify?
deficiency
ExplanationThe suffix '-penia' signifies deficiency.
#12
The suffix '-rrhexis' in medical terminology refers to what condition?
rupture
ExplanationThe condition indicated by the suffix '-rrhexis' is rupture.
#13
What is the meaning of the suffix '-plasty'?
surgical repair
ExplanationSuffix '-plasty' signifies surgical repair.
#14
What is the meaning of the suffix '-cyte'?
cell
ExplanationThe suffix '-cyte' refers to a cell.
#15
What is the meaning of the suffix '-phagia'?
swallowing or eating
ExplanationThe suffix '-phagia' means swallowing or eating.
